
Davao del Sur Electric Cooperative, Inc. (DASURECO) and Maharlika Charity Foundation, Inc. (MCFI) officially sealed a humanitarian partnership with the signing of a Memorandum of Agreement (MOA) on March 18, 2025. This collaboration marks a milestone in DASURECO’s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) initiatives as it launches Project Ngiti, a transformative program under its Mission Happiness initiative.
The agreement paves the way for providing free surgeries to individuals with cleft lip and cleft palate, and correction of clubfoot. DASURECO, celebrating its 50th Founding Anniversary, aims to make a lasting impact by helping restore not just smiles but confidence and dignity to beneficiaries. The Cooperative will spearhead case-finding efforts, facilitate patient referrals, and share transportation costs, while MCFI will shoulder the full expenses of medical procedures and specialist care.
With this partnership, both organizations reaffirm their commitment to uplifting lives beyond geographical boundaries, ensuring that every eligible individual, regardless of location, has access to life-changing medical treatment. This initiative underscores the power of collaboration in bringing hope and healing to those in need.
If you have a loved one or know someone who might benefit, please review the eligibility criteria below:
For Cleft Surgeries: The individual should be at least 1 year old, weigh more than 10 kg, and be free from cough, runny nose, or fever.
For Clubfoot Correction: The patient should be between 2 months and 16 years old.
